2x−(x+2)=10 What is X?

Respuesta :

09pqr4sT
09pqr4sT 09pqr4sT
  • 01-07-2020

Answer:

x = 12

Step-by-step explanation:

2x-(x+2) = 10

Distribute the negative sign to the brackets.

2x-x-2 = 10

Subtract the like terms.

1x - 2 = 10

Add 2 on both sides.

1x = 10 + 2

x = 12
